A couple of weeks back we all heard about the Chicago Transit Authority removing GTA 4 ads, their argument was to protect the children, they didn't want to advertise for such an adult game. Then you have misguided assholes like Jack Thompson who sure is loving all of this controversy, GTA 4 gives him something to bitch about. But I do not understand, never once did Rockstar make an advertisement that was geared towards kids, in fact they have said all along that this was an adult game. The GTA series is geared towards and marketed towards adults, what's the harm them? Rockstar isn't the only ones who get shitted on by grumpy adults in power; in fact video games in general get it. How many times have you heard "Video games cause violence"? I call bullshit! These adult games are adult games, made for adults, just b/c it's a video game doesn't mean it is ok for your little 9 year old.
Let's take a step back and look at this, so GTA and other M rated games are adult games, these games are not meant to end up in children's hands, yet (I can speak from first hand experience being a former EB Games employee) the majority of the times these kinda games do end up in a child's hands is through their parents.

So this last Sunday, I attended the most exciting exhibit of the year (in my hometown) -
The Calgary Comic & Entertainment Expo. It's no San Diego Comic Con, but it was 15 minutes from home, and absolutely satisfying...
The expo was packed with tons of actors, such as: Matthew Wood: Voice of General Grevievous in Star Wars. Kevin Sorbo: Hercules in Hercules: The Legendary Journeys, and Xena Warrior Princess. Tricia Helfer: Best known from her role as Cylon Number 6 in Battlestar Galactica. George Takei: helmsman Hikaru Sulu from the original Star Trek, to name a few.

A group of students from IT University of Copenhagen in Denmark who all work at a bar together called Scrollbar decided to have a Mario themed night. They came up with all these drinks as a result, so mad props to them. Here are a few of their drink mixes, to see the rest visit their site scrollbar.dk.
